Castletown Commissioners are inviting people to a celebration marking the 130th anniversary of Poulsom Park.
The event will be held in the park from 1pm and 5pm on Sunday, June 28.
There'll be a march by the Castletown Metropolitan Silver Band, Manx dancing and a display of vintage trains.
And children will be able to enjoy games, a treasure hunt and art activities.
